Audric, as usual, knocked on Calent's door and scarcely waited for an invitation before entering.  It wasn't his business, of course, what Calent did or did not do with the woman waiting in the parlor -- but he'd been a soldier too long not to notice...certain assets.

And, he, for one, approved of her gifts.  Some might find them odd, but whoever operated as the Chandos Family rumor-monger had done an excellent job in assessing Calent's personality and interests.  Yes, it was certainly unusual...

"Lady Kathryn of Highheart has arrived," he began without preamble.  It usually wasn't his duty to announce visitors, but he had volunteered this time around...  With his usual, roguish grin, he added, "I can see why the King of Thieves wanted to propose to her.  She's not hard on the eyes."

Calent had buried himself away that day. It was an obsession of his, and the last two unaccounted for coppers would not be missed the second time through.  He didn't know why he paid these tax collectors, but he supposed he shouldn't make such a fuss over a petty two coins, but.. even still, the money had to account for something. This was not his money, after all, but the money that went back to his people, fixing roads, building a new and giving leniencies where necessary if the funds proved fruitful that year (an idea that seemed to keep the people more appreciable of their taxes).

Papers were everywhere, and an extra ledger was brought in from storage. Calent continued to scribble with his quill, making a fuss over this and that, writing furiously before finally, with a sigh, tossing the paper aside and peering up and through a ledger at his friend.


He almost seemed to wrinkle his nose, but rather gave a sniff when the famous thief was mentioned.
"If you approve, perhaps she should just be dismissed." Though his tone seemed cold, Audric might know that it was his soured attempt at humor.  "I still haven't found those two coppers. But I think I know what two villages it could have been missed by." Ignoring what Audric was presenting, he went on to talk about the tax as she leaned back in his chair.
"The tax collector near the river was new, his position heir ed to him when his father went ill. Though they know my strict policy, I wouldn't put it pass him to make a mistake." He rubbed at the bridge of his nose, smudging just the faintest blot of ink high upon his cheek before he turned to Audric.

Audric grinned at the sight of the smudge.  He'd let the lady outside point it out to him later, if she chose to do so.  If she didn't, well, then, Calent would walk around with a smudge of ink on his face until he himself noticed!  Either way, it would be good fun.

For him, anyway.

Calent could talk about taxes all he liked.  Audric's sisters both had heads for math and coins; Audric preferred the subject of Anatomy -- female in particular, but he was also quite good at knowing where to stab a man to bring him to his knees without necessarily dooming him...

"If coins are all that you're interested in, I could, perhaps, interest you in a dowry proposal?  I hear the Duke of Highheart would pay a man handsomely for the privilege of seeing his eldest daughter wed within the year."  He shrugged lightly, although he was still grinning.  He knew he sounded like a nag, but Calent did need a little encouragement.  What sort of a man preferred taxes to the company of a woman?

"Or, perhaps, you would like to hear about the gifts she has brought from her father as an apology for the stain upon your name.  There's no coin, but I do think you'll enjoy them, Calent."

Calent only stared, and continued to stare at his friend before sighing.
"You've peaked my interest, I'm enthralled," he replied flatly, again, another way he'd ever show his jest as he pressed his hands to the table to rise.  "I am well aware of the gossip, a certain man posing as myself is not only a smack at the duchy of Highheart, but my own reputation as well." he frowned outwardly for saying it, though he knew he had already stated that before in privacy to his friend.
"It is flattering, their notion, but what do you think the people would see if a false proposal had occured, then a real one, of the same effect, soon after?"
His eyes caught something on the paper as he moved away, growling.
"The two coppers.." he growled, snatching up a paper and sighed, smacking his hand on the paper.
"The fees he forgot when tolling across the Norther bridge."
And the frown Calent wore now was immense as he sighed, not even bothering to note it as he tossed the damned thing aside and pressed his thumb ad finger to his eyes and sighed.

Wrinkling his nose, he pulled his hand away and looked towards Audric.
"So, I suppose you're waiting for my cue to allow you the luxury of offering me all of the details." He almost smiled, a twitch on his lips as he shrugged and crossed his arms over his chest. "My approval never halted your tongue from just telling me before." he stared at Audric, simply waiting for him to dish out all of his knowledge about this woman-

After all, who knew...
Maybe it would be intriguing to wed the girl who was falsely proposed. It would put an end to any of the gossip around himself- who currently was at such an age that no bride and no heir was almost  scandal in itself.

Audric chuckled at his friend.  "Yes, but I do have to make sure you're paying attention, don't I?" he asked smugly before accepting the invitation.

"Lady Kathryn Chandos is said to be quite beautiful -- a fact I can attest to now, and you shall see for yourself shortly.  Her beauty is only exceeded, in equal parts, by her modesty and piety.  She attends Church at least three times each week -- enough for both of you -- and is a pillar of charity and kindness towards the poor.  Her people love her dearly, and even your people, after hearing such things, are enraged that the King of Thieves would prey upon such an innocent creature."  He paused, then added, "And there is a particularly nasty rumor that the man killed one of the Lady's suitors -- a Lord Philippe of Brisaelia -- and two guards for interfering when the villain attempted to have his way with the Lady."  Audric wasn't quite sure he believed that -- it was quite fanciful, although he wouldn't put it past the King of Thieves to stoop to rape.

"All of that aside, she loves to hunt and to ride, they say, and she is a charming hostess and obedient daughter."

Audric shrugged lightly.  "You could do worse in a bride.  And the other nobles are looking to you to set an example.  Turn her away, and the family will be shunned.  Treat her kindly, and the rest of the Kingdom would treat you as a hero, I imagine, for rescuing the poor, innocent girl."

Kathryn rose as the pair of men stepped into the parlor.  She recognized the guard, of course, and assumed the man in the finer clothing must be Calent.

Well, she thought, he wasn't bad looking...  There was a certain familiarity about him that reminded her of Dekka -- but, perhaps, it was just something of the coloring...

"Duke Calent?  I am Lady Kathryn Chandos, daughter of Harald Chandos, Duke of Highheart.  My father bade me to deliver to you this letter in his hand, as well as some items which he dearly hoped would make amends for the recent events in Highheart."

She assumed he already knew of those events...

Kathryn became momentarily distracted by the smudge of ink, made suddenly apparent as he stepped further into the room.  And, of course, once seen, the ink could not again be unseen...

The smile that answered his greeting was as cool as his own, although her blue eyes sparkled with humor that remained apart from her mask.  "You do me a great honor to welcome me with such kind words to your beautiful duchy," she murmured lightly.

She glanced towards the guard that had accompanied the Duke, noting that he was watching their exchange with a fair amount of interest...and with a smirk.  She had to wonder if the ink smudge on the Duke's face was no accident at all...

"As I said earlier, I do also have gifts my father wished presented to you.  Due to their nature, they remain outside in my carriage.  If you wish, we can view them at your leisure."

"As you wish, Duke Calent," Kathryn stated prettily.  There was the small problem of the smudge...  Given the solemnity and formality of the occasion -- and the fact she had heard only of his reserved, almost cold nature -- she wasn't at all sure it would be proper to simply blurt it out...

She would have to compromise.

She followed Audric willingly towards the doors, then paused in front of the large mirror set beside the doorway.  "May I have my jacket and gloves, please?" she requested of one of the servants hovering beside the door.  As he scuttled off to see to her request, she turned towards the mirror as if just noticing it.

"This is a beautiful mirror, Duke Calent," she offered, as though making small-talk as they waited.  In truth, she wanted to lure him over to the reflective surface so that he might catch a glimpse of the smudge himself...  "Is it an heirloom?"

Kathryn turned away when it became apparent he had noticed the smudge himself, becoming rather engrossed with the door as the servant helped her on with her coat.  By the time she had her jacket buttoned up and her gloves on, she saw that the smudge had vanished.

And the captain of Calent's guard was looking about as pleased as a cat in the cream.

"Of course," she answered, as though nothing were amiss.  Out into the courtyard they went.  Kathryn led the procession over to her carriage.  A footman bowed lowly to them, then set down an ornate chest.

Kathryn opened the trunk herself.  From it, she withdrew two items: a beautiful bow bearing Calent's coat of arms, and a quiver of fine arrows.  Each piece of the collection was a piece of work by itself, and, although it likely had been expensive, it was made to be used rather than hung on a mantle; Calent would find no gaudy gemstones or flashy, unbalancing fixtures.

"My father shares your passion for hunting," she murmured respectively, as she held out the items towards him.  She handled them carefully -- and she seemed to know her way around a bow.  "He hopes you will have occasion to use this bow.  He hopes you may accept a future invitation to the Valley for a hunt so that the bow comes to serve as a symbol of friendship formed through a common endeavor."

Kathryn smiled through her blush, peeking at him through her long lashes.  She was genuinely pleased -- it was the sort of thing Dekka disguised as Calent had said, and it did appeal to her ladylike sensibilities.

"My parents will be honored to hear of your decision, Duke Calent, and I, myself, am overjoyed at the thought of traveling in your company.  And overwhelmed by your kind words."  For some reason, she hadn't expected him to be so similar to the role Dekka had played...  She half-expected him to say something scandalous next.  "My only duty in Allar was to deliver my father's words and gifts to you.  It is a beautiful country, however, and had I a proper escort, I should have lingered to cherish the sights.  And the company."  Her smile widened slightly, and she glanced modestly away, although her tone left no doubt as to who she meant.  "Unfortunately, my father had pressing business, and I have no brothers nor uncles who could provide me escort."  Obviously, the handful of guardsmen that had accompanied her didn't count.  And she certainly wasn't about to suggest he put her up -- that was a decision he would have to come to on his own!

Audric's expression, meanwhile, was just short of gaping.  For Calent to suddenly decide to accompany the young woman was...well, something of a miracle.  He liked to barb his friend -- and lecture him -- but he hadn't imagined he would warm up so quickly to the girl!

"Of course, Duke Calent.  And, I am certain there would be no dishonor in spending time in the company of an esteemed gentleman such as yourself."  Assuming, of course, their time was not spent in his bedroom or entirely in her carriage...  He was a Duke, after all, and more credit was given to him than to, say, a lowly thief.

"I do hope my presence here is not an imposition," she went on with a warm, grateful smile.  "My footman can see to my baggage."  She made a vague gesture in aforementioned servant's direction.  She assumed he would find room for her servants -- the footman, the driver, the maid, and the handful of guards in her company.  "I'm embarrassed to confess we did not give you proper warning of my arrival."

A letter had been sent, of course, but a mere letter stating that an envoy would be sent was not the same thing as the Duke's own daughter turning up...

"Yes, we have many guests quarters for you and your servants," the duke went on, bowing to her with natural grace as he offered her an arm. "We can send a messenger out to notify your father that we will be arriving, so as not to surprise him with an unexpected guest as you return. Naturally, I would only offer you the finest rooms in all of my castle, the entire guest hall being yours. And you needn't worry yourself over the surprise, it was.. a refreshing change from the bland  daily occurrences I feel chained to here in Allar. Come, let me show you the grounds."
And as he moved away with Kathryn on his arm, he shot a nasty glance back towards Audric.

As the two strolled about the castle, the Duke informing her about each and every room, and even the details behind some of the portraits, the would find themselves infront of a great painting of Calent and his mother and father, a family portrait baring the stoic faces of the Allarrick breed.  Though Calent was much younger there, it was evident he was even handsome in his youth and his green eyes, nearly appearing lost in the canvas.


"This is our family portrait. Painted some time ago," The duke informed, hands clasped behind his back, shoulder's straight and at attention. "It is only a sad regret my parents are not alive here today to help tend to the castle." He forced a smile for her, a professional one. "But I'd like to think we do alright for here."
